What is the first thing I should do when I discover a major water leak?
Immediately locate and shut off the main water supply valve. This is the critical first step in 'loss of use' mitigation. For properties near Eastern Arizona College, knowing your utility emergency contact and valve location is essential. Rapid source containment limits the volume of Category 1 water, preventing escalation to more hazardous categories and reducing the overall scope and cost of restoration.
How quickly can mold start growing after water damage in my home?
The mold growth window is 48–72 hours from the initial intrusion under ideal conditions. My insurer says my leak is 'Clean Water.' What does that mean, and how can I lower my premium?
Category 1 'Clean Water' originates from a sanitary source, like a broken supply line. This is distinct from Category 3 'Black Water,' which is grossly contaminated from sewage or flooding. For Clean Water claims, proper mitigation prevents category escalation. Installing IoT leak sensors (e.g., Moen Flo) can provide up to a 5% premium credit discount in Arizona, as they enable automatic shut-off and immediate alert, minimizing loss severity.
My Thatcher home feels dry to the touch after a leak. Why do you say it's still wet?
Surface dryness is deceptive. For structural materials to be truly dry, the moisture in the air inside them must be in equilibrium with the ambient air. The IICRC S500 standard of care for Thatcher's climate requires drying to a psychrometric standard of 40 Grains Per Pound (GPP) at 70°F. This measures vapor pressure, not surface moisture. Materials at higher GPP will continue to release vapor, leading to hidden damage.
